The 2022 Super Bowl will feature the Los Angeles Rams and Cincinnati Bengals with the Lombardi Trophy on the line. The quarterback matchup will feature two players making their Super Bowl debuts at very different stages of their career, with Joe Burrow leading the Bengals in his second season, while Matthew Stafford is in his 13th. The latest 2022 Super Bowl odds from Caesars Sportsbook lists the Rams as four-point favorites, while the over-under is 48.5. Super Bowl 2022 will be played at SoFi Stadium in Los Angeles and kickoff is scheduled for 6:30 p.m. ET on Sunday.
